可能限制特定用户控件对特定角色的访问吗?按角色对usercontrol的受限访问
我有页(Default.aspx的),该负载(也)info.ascx
我wanto受限访问info.ascx并显示如“未授权”他是要装载的消息。
谢谢!
可能限制特定用户控件对特定角色的访问吗?按角色对usercontrol的受限访问
我有页(Default.aspx的),该负载(也)info.ascx
我wanto受限访问info.ascx并显示如“未授权”他是要装载的消息。
谢谢!
ASP.Net中没有内置任何东西。您必须使用角色提供者和自定义用户控件来实现自己的访问控制。
您可以使用
<authorization>
<allow users="user1, user2"/>
<deny users=”?”/>
</authorization>
这篇文章可以帮助: http://www.codeproject.com/Articles/301324/Authorization-in-ASP-NET
我试过这个用户控件(ascx文件),它没有工作。 –
查看答案在这里:https://stackoverflow.com/questions/2433305/how-can-i-limit-asp -net-控制措施为基础,对用户的角色。其中一些应该对用户控制也有帮助。 –